When comparing GeForce 940MX and GeForce MX110, we look primarily at benchmarks and game tests. But it is not only about the numbers. Often you can find third-party models with higher clock speeds, better cooling, or a customizable RGB lighting. Not all of them will have all the features you need. Another thing to consider is the port selection. Most graphics cards have at least one DisplayPort and HDMI interface, but some monitors require DVI. Before you buy, check the TDP of the graphics card — this characteristic will help you estimate the consumption of the graphics card. You may even have to upgrade your PSU to meet its requirements. An important factor when choosing between GeForce 940MX and GeForce MX110 is the price. Does the additional cost justify the performance hit? Our comparison should help you make the right decision.

GeForce 940MX and GeForce MX110 are Laptop Graphics Cards

Note: GeForce 940MX and GeForce MX110 are only used in laptop graphics. They have lower GPU clock speed compared to the desktop variant, which results in lower power consumption, but also 10-30% lower gaming performance. Check available laptop models with GeForce 940MX or GeForce MX110 here:

  • GeForce MX110 has 30% more power consumption, than GeForce 940MX.
  • GeForce 940MX is connected by PCIe 3.0 x8, and GeForce MX110 uses PCIe 3.0 x16 interface.
  • GeForce 940MX has 2 GB more memory, than GeForce MX110.
  • Both cards are used in Laptops.
  • GeForce 940MX and GeForce MX110 are build with Maxwell architecture.
  • Core clock speed of GeForce 940MX is 157 MHz higher, than GeForce MX110.
  • GeForce 940MX and GeForce MX110 are manufactured by 28 nm process technology.
  • Memory clock speed of GeForce 940MX is 2200 MHz higher, than GeForce MX110.
